I've done no-stay MRs to LHR and NRT, as well as short-stay runs to those cities and ZRH, EZE and GIG.

Never had any problems in any of those cities - but occasionally had an a-hole of an immigration agent back here in the US upon return. LAX is usually the worst, while MIA and JFK seem used to the concept of MRs.

Never any checked bags on a mileage run (nor on business trips, as a rule).

Plenty of quick turn MRs in the US - ALB, PVD, JFK, DCA, JAX, MIA, MCO, LAX, SFO, SAN, and SDF, to name a few. Never any problems checking in or boarding, but FAs can be a little shocked to see your face on the return flight just 15 minutes after you arrived.
